## Break-Glass Access — Timetabler "Slotwise"

If the Slotwise scheduler at Fennwick Academy goes sideways during term planning and nobody with admin rights is reachable, you can use the break-glass account. It bypasses SSO entirely, so treat it like a fire axe: smash only when needed, log everything after. The account is `slotwise-breakglass` on the staging bastion; it unlocks the solver config vault too. Access is audited weekly by the Penhallow security crew. The recovery passphrase for the vault is below.

vault phrase of hahop-badug = novvan-ulaion-zorius-noviel-gorwyn-casix-tamys

### Step 3: Enable idempotency keys on payment retries

Before promoting the Copperfen Payments build, confirm that every retry path attaches an idempotency key derived from the original charge attempt. Duplicate charges during the last incident traced back to retries without keys. Keys expire after 24 hours; replays past expiry are rejected, not re-executed. The release is blocked until the gateway is running with the following configuration values.

settings of kajep-kawip:
[zorys]
host = zorys.urlaqgrid.corp
user = zorys_svc
database = zorys_prod

For support: this release changes several defaults in the Spoolwright printer-spooler microservice. Jobs that fail rendering are now held for review instead of being silently discarded, which means customers may report "stuck" jobs that previously vanished — this is expected. The retry interval was lengthened to reduce duplicate prints on flaky office networks, and the queue depth cap was raised. When troubleshooting, compare a customer's settings against the new shipped defaults, which appear below.

deployment values, yadug-bawif:
[framir]
team = pelox
access_code = ac_a38ab2
owner = tamion.julael
host = framir.tolvaqlabs.test
port = 11211
peer = tammir.zemvargrid.local
salt = 2215ef03
pin = 1541